无法创建OverbyteICS简单TCP服务器,没有回声和没有行模式

时间:2016-01-21 18:45:29

标签: delphi tcp delphi-xe2

**编辑** 好的:糟糕的问题:我的pb不在我的代码中,而是在PuTTY配置中! 由于我有一些信息要添加,我不会关闭这个问题。我会这样做并给出答案。

我在Delphi XE2中使用OverbyteICS(非常好)库(V8)。我只是在尝试创建一个非常基本的TCP服务器时遇到问题,该服务器显示Telnet客户端(如PuTTY)字符(实时)而不将它们重新发送到客户端(无回显)。 我使用了ICS中的一些示例,主要是OverbyteIcsSrvDemo或OverbyteIcsTcpSrv,但我遇到了同样的问题:如果我ECHO一切正常,但如果我没有ECHO,则Telnet客户端必须发送CR + LF来显示字符。

我的测试代码在这里:http://collabedit.com/9f9h4

我尝试使用LineMode这样的属性但没有成功。

1 个答案:

答案 0 :(得分:0)

至于在我的问题中已经解释过,我的代码片段还可以,但我的PuTTY配置不当。 主要问题是选项"终端/本地线编辑"是在' Auto'所以PuTTY正在等待回归'发送字符串的键。 我也感到很不安,因为当我发送回信时(在我的代码上)由于某些原因PuTTY发送字符而没有等待'返回'。

相关问题